Transaction bb24b0cc695779a31e4a3492c0e2106015a21cf8dad51aabb31b65d3aef43e62
1 Input
1 Output
-
bb24b0cc695779a31e4a3492c0e2106015a21cf8dad51aabb31b65d3aef43e62:0
- value
- 10982329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cbf8ceafe97ee8d55242bb214c58696bf3c09e5 OP_EQUAL
- address
- 34K2K5GLksTexDvZ1J4pgW5zGCj3jRhTw8